What the numbers mean

The CPU score is the processor's own performance — that is what we rank on. GAMING is the whole rig's score in the best PC we measured the processor in, and leans heavily on the graphics card. A strong processor in a weak PC gets a low GAMING score without being worse. We show both and never mix them.

All numbers come from our benchmark suite: four hand-built 3D scenes written directly against the graphics APIs in Rust, the same load on every PC. The methodology is open at https://whatfps.com/metodik
